Delving into the core workings of a computer often begins with understanding its hardware components. These physical parts compose the structure upon which software operates, enabling tasks extending from simple calculations to complex simulations. The CPU acts as the conductor, implementing instructions at lightning speed.
Furthermore, memory, such as RAM, contains data and instructions immediately retrievable to the CPU. Storage devices like hard drives or SSDs provide long-term data retention, while input/output devices facilitate interaction with the outside world.
Mastering the roles and interactions of these components, one can gain a deeper appreciation of how computers function.

Addressing Common Hardware Faults
When your computer or other hardware devices begin acting up, it can be frustrating. Luckily, many common hardware problems are solvable with a little bit of troubleshooting. The first step is to identify the signs of the issue. Are you experiencing slow performance, locking up? Is your device making unusual noises? Once you've pinpointed the problem, you can start to troubleshoot potential causes. Common culprits include faulty hardware, software issues, or even overheating.
A good place to start is by checking all your wires. Make sure everything is plugged in securely and that there are no loose leads. You can also try restarting your device. Sometimes, a simple restart can fix minor software glitches. If the issue persists, you may need to consult your device's guidebook for more specific troubleshooting steps or contact the manufacturer for support.
